Drunk Driving Incident and Immediate Aftermath
On the weekend of November 15, 2023, Lucas Adams, known for his role as Noah Newman on *The Young and the Restless*, experienced a personal crisis when his sister, Audrie Farris, was seriously injured in a head-on collision caused by a drunk driver. In a heartfelt Instagram post, Adams shared a photo of the wrecked vehicle and detailed the severity of the incident, stating, “My sister was hit head-on by a drunk driver over the weekend. Thankfully, she is going to be okay, but has a long road ahead of her as her hip and foot were broken.”
Farris, who has eight children, faces a challenging recovery that will require surgeries and extensive rehabilitation. Adams emphasized the need for support for his sister's family during this difficult time, sharing her Venmo account for donations to assist with medical and household expenses.
Community Response and Scamming Incident
The response from fans and the daytime community was immediate and supportive, with many eager to help the family. However, the situation was complicated by the emergence of a scammer who created a fake Venmo account, attempting to exploit the family's crisis. Adams quickly alerted his followers to the fraudulent account, clarifying that the correct Venmo username is “audriefarris” in all lowercase with one “s.” This prompt action helped protect potential donors from being misled.
